Transaction 38958257e2632733bbb28ccb047dd5bb5ca83098b8101030e7d8a5fe56888373

1 Input
2 Outputs
  • 38958257e2632733bbb28ccb047dd5bb5ca83098b8101030e7d8a5fe56888373:0
  • value  3754914
    address  1NZy7Ar7may7V7LaoFsCDphX1yjV4tFq3Y
  • 38958257e2632733bbb28ccb047dd5bb5ca83098b8101030e7d8a5fe56888373:1
  • value  1396686
    address  36vz6QYAd53Su6vFy4xg59V9V57HHVzo4p